Fairmont has been a dominant force so far, but they're in the middle of a mini-slump at the moment. They took a 71-59 hit to the loss column at the hands of the Union Pines Vikings on Monday. The Golden Tornadoes were down 58-34 at the end of the third quarter, which was just too much to recover from.
Fairmont's defeat came despite a true team effort from the offense, with many players turning in solid performances. Perhaps the best among them was Josiah Billings, who dropped a double-double on 15 points and 15 boards. Another player making a difference was Landon Cummings, who posted 21 points and six rebounds.
Even though they lost, Fairmont smashed the offensive glass and finished the game with 24 offensive boards. They easily outclassed their opponents in that department as Union Pines only pulled down six offensive rebounds.
Union Pines' win was the result of several impressive offensive performances. One of the most notable came from Aiden Leonard, who went 8 for 12 en route to 22 points and three steals. That's the most points Leonard has posted since back in December of 2023. The team also got some help courtesy of Jaylen Kyle, who went 8 of 13 on his way to 17 points.
Fairmont's loss ended a three-game streak of away wins and brought them to 10-5. As for Union Pines, they are on a roll lately: they've won nine of their last 12 contests, which provided a nice bump to their 12-6 record this season.
Fairmont will take on West Bladen at 7:30 p.m. on Friday. West Bladen will roll in looking for their ninth straight victory, something Fairmont surely won't give up without a fight. As for Union Pines, they will face off against Lee County at 7:30 p.m. on Friday. Lee County is strutting in with some offensive muscle as they've averaged 53.9 points per game this season.
